Transaction 1e17993c3ab13a248e02e4253342f5c0011fbdea737c30e0f2ece56f22e15a9c
1 Input
1 Output
-
1e17993c3ab13a248e02e4253342f5c0011fbdea737c30e0f2ece56f22e15a9c:0
- value
- 18933164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50827d7c38e425a1a091ad62bc1c7cbc56130974 OP_EQUAL
- address
- 392iJWLWLrixH3RmbBNEK7XmaaMo32NRUB